The Country-to-Country CTF (C2C) Cybersecurity Challenge is a series of international CTF competitions organized by the International Cyber Security – Center of Excellence (INCS-CoE) with leading international universities. The 2026 competition is hosted by Universitas Indonesia. C2C is an exciting opportunity for students to work together as international teams to solve interesting CTF challenges, learn new skills, socialize, and promote international collaboration and friendship. Interested university students across Japan, Singapore, Indonesia, or any one of the countries that are a part (party or signatory) of the Budapest Convention can participate in the qualifying competition on February 6 – 7, 2026. The final round of team competition will be held at Universitas Indonesia, Bali, on August 10 – 14, 2026 |

Cyber Atlas (CAE Cyber Competitions Atlas)
A comprehensive, interactive directory of cybersecurity competitions curated by the CAE (Centers of Academic Excellence) Community. Cyber Atlas lets students and educators explore, filter, and connect with cyber events — like CTFs, policy strategy contests, and live-defense competitions — based on location, education level, and other criteria.
